Death is a cunning and sinister individual whose sole purpose is to take the souls of the deceased. Although he waits for people to die naturally, if someone angers or offends him enough, he will physically manifest in order to attempt to take their life by force.

Death, also referred to as the Wolf or Lobo, is the physical embodiment of death, who takes the form of a white wolf in a black poncho. He is intent on killing the legendary Puss in Boots once and for all, as punishment for carelessly wasting eight of his nine lives. Here's the point where Puss in Boots transforms from a fearless adventurer to a tamed pet. His fear of Lobo develops into what is clearly a panic disorder, which is another more mature theme that The Last Wish wasn't afraid to portray. Perrito, or Perro, is a therapy dog to Puss in Boots and the tritagonist in the DreamWorks film, Puss in Boots: The Last Wish. He started out as one of Mama Luna's pet cats, because he disguised himself as a cat. He met Puss, and they became fast friends, at least in Perrito's eyes. Death, also referred to as the Wolf or Lobo, is the main antagonist of DreamWorks' 43rd full-length animated film Puss in Boots: The Last Wish, a spin-off of the Shrek franchise. Death is a large, silvery-white, bipedal wolf with an elongated snout, gray "mask" marking on his face, sharp teeth, and bright red eyes that glow when he's excited. He wears a black riding cloak with a built-in hood.
